#2 of Unimportant Verse About Important People

Resuscitating ancient coins in class, we learned,  
takes a toothbrush and olive oil.  
Slow, steady strokes across, around...  
soft bristles dislodging soil  
one speck at a time.  
But no one that day was nearly as blessed,  
seeing a coin shine through  
at the end, full relief brightly expressed,  
as I was to see you smile.
